Question 1 of 5
The mother of a 4-year-old child tells a nurse that her child is reluctant to go to bed at night. Which of the following responses should the nurse make?
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Keeping a night light on provides a sense of security and comfort for a child who may be afraid of the dark, easing the transition to bedtime.
Question 2 of 5
A parent asks a nurse about toys to provide for an 11-month-old infant. Which of the following toys should the nurse suggest?
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Push-pull toys help with walking development and coordination, suitable for an 11-month-old starting to take steps.

Question 4 of 5
A nurse is reinforcing teaching with new parents on the proper way to use an infant car seat. Which of the following statements by the parents should indicate to the nurse a need for further teaching?
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Allowing a baby to watch the driver indicates a forward-facing position, which is unsafe for infants; rear-facing provides better protection.
Question 5 of 5
A nurse provides care to a 6-month-old infant. Which observation should be reported to the pediatrician?
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: Head lag in a 6-month-old indicates a delay in motor development and should be reported as it can signal neurological issues.
